Explosions happen in total silence. Poorly designed enemies noclip across walls. Boring missions, impossible to play in singleplayer since it is not balanced. In easy mode, monsters simply forget to spawn. Do i need to say anything else? A good concept ruined by a terrible execution. i can add a trigger sound in 3 minutes, and if the developers are too lazy to do even that, this game is not to be taken seriously.

Organ Trail is a simple yet amusing parody of the original Oregon Trail. PROS: -The horrifying keyboard aiming from Oregon Trail is nowhere to be found -Faithfully recreates the original graphics and sounds -Fun supply management -Runs super smooth in all machines, good price for what you get -Entertaining minigames CONS: -Another zombie game? heh. -The Steam page claims it to be a psychological challenge. That may be true, if you consider "click and drag to kill" to be anything more than laughable. This is not a psychological struggle game, it is supply management. -In 7 playthroughs i encountered 3 special events. The game claims that there are over 35, but if the chances to encounter one are slightly smaller than the chances of getting hit by a lightning, i don´t see why i should play 50 more times to encounter them all. -Some achievements in Steam are broken even after a fix version was released, and the updates to fix said bugs are not going to come. A decent adaptation from the classic. Good for people who liked the original or enjoy supply management, but delivers less than the trailer leads us to believe.
